Wikipedia : This day (January 17, 1952), in Tokyo, Japan, is born Ryuichi Sakamoto, a Japanese musician, composer and actor.
Ryuichi Sakamoto :
@ allmusic.com : The driving force behind Neo Geo — a cutting-edge fusion combining Asian and Western classical music with other global textures and rhythms — pioneering electronic composer Ryuichi Sakamoto was among the most innovative artists to emerge during the 1980s.
@last.fm : His 1999 musical composition “Energy Flow” is the first number-one instrumental single in the Japan’s Oricon charts history. He was ranked at number 59 in a list of the top 100 most influential musicians compiled by HMV.
@Discogs : He has also written soundtracks for Pedro Almodovar’s film High Heels, and Oliver Stone’s Wild Palms. Sakamoto was married to a Japanese pianist and singer Akiko Yano, collaborating with her on some of her recordings.
